How We Tackle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1)

When clean water invades your home, the clock starts ticking. It’s crucial to act fast to prevent secondary damage like swelling wood or stained ceilings. Our process is designed to be effective and efficient, focusing on thorough water extraction and drying. We don’t cut corners because we know that means more problems for you down the line, so you can count on our team for a truly professional approach.

1. Initial Assessment and Water Extraction

First, we’ll assess the source and extent of the water damage. Then, we use powerful extraction tools to remove standing water as quickly as possible. This critical first step helps prevent water from spreading and soaking deeper into your home’s materials. We aim to have this part completed within a few hours, depending on the amount of water.

2. Drying and Dehumidifying

Once the bulk of the water is gone, we bring in industrial-strength air movers and dehumidifiers. These machines work to reduce humidity levels and pull moisture out of the air and building materials. This stage can take anywhere from a few days to a week, depending on the affected materials and the size of the area.

3. Moisture Monitoring

Throughout the drying process, we use specialized meters to measure moisture content in floors, walls, and even inside cabinets. This ensures that we’re drying effectively and that no hidden moisture remains. We continue monitoring until your home reaches safe, dry levels, typically for another 2-3 days.

4. Cleaning and Sanitizing

After your property is dry, we’ll clean and sanitize all affected areas. This step is important for removing any potential contaminants and ensuring your home is safe and healthy. We pay attention to thorough disinfection to give you peace of mind.

5. Restoration and Rebuilding

Finally, we’ll take care of any necessary repairs or rebuilding. This might include replacing damaged drywall, repainting, or fixing flooring. Our goal is to return your home to its pre-loss condition, making it look and feel like new again.

Warning Signs You Need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1)

Catching water damage early can save you a lot of money and hassle. Keep an eye out for these common signs, and don’t ignore them. Early detection means a much simpler repair process and prevents bigger, more expensive problems later on.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, damp, or musty smell is often the first sign of hidden moisture. It usually means water has gotten into areas you can’t see, like behind walls or under floors, and has started to affect materials. This is a clear indicator of trouble.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

You might notice new spots or rings on your ceilings, walls, or carpets. These stains are direct evidence of water intrusion and can spread if the source isn’t addressed. They’re a visual cue that needs attention.

Warped or Peeling Walls and Ceilings

When materials like drywall or wood absorb too much water, they can start to swell, warp, or even peel. This is a sign of significant moisture saturation and indicates that structural integrity might be compromised.

Damp or Soggy Carpeting and Flooring

If your carpets feel unusually wet or your hardwood floors look warped or bubbled, it’s a direct result of water exposure. This condition requires immediate drying to prevent permanent damage and potential mold issues.

Increased Humidity or Foggy Windows

A sudden rise in indoor humidity, especially if it causes windows to fog up, can mean there’s an unseen water source. This excess moisture in the air is a sign that drying efforts are needed.

Doors or Cabinets That Stick

If doors and drawers in your home suddenly become difficult to open or close, it could be due to expanding wood from absorbed moisture. This subtle change can signal that water has affected the structural components of your home.

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1) v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small spill on tile floor from a dropped glass Yes No Easy to clean up, minimal risk of damage.
Leaky toilet tank causing water around the base Yes, cautiously Yes, if prolonged Can be a sign of a more significant plumbing issue or under-floor damage.
Appliance hose burst (e.g., washing machine, dishwasher) No Yes Water can spread quickly and saturate subflooring and walls.
Pipe burst in an accessible area No Yes Requires professional extraction and drying to prevent hidden mold.
Water seeping from a foundation crack after heavy rain No Yes Indicates potential structural issues and significant water intrusion.
Overflowing bathtub or sink Yes, if caught immediately Yes, if water sits for hours Prolonged contact with water can damage subfloors and drywall.

While small, isolated incidents might be manageable for a DIY approach, any situation involving significant water volume, hidden moisture, or potential structural impact is best handled by professionals. Our team has the tools and expertise to ensure your property is dried completely and safely.

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1) Cost In Laveen, AZ

The cost for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1) in Laveen, AZ, can vary based on several factors. These include the size of the affected area, the amount of water, and how long the water has been present. The following are general estimates, and an on-site assessment is always needed for an accurate quote.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Amount of water, accessibility, and time needed.
Structural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) $750 – $3,000 Size of the space, type of materials being dried, and duration.
Moisture Monitoring & Testing $300 – $1,000 Number of checks, advanced equipment used, and area coverage.
Cleaning & Sanitizing Affected Areas $400 – $1,500 Square footage, type of cleaning agents required, and depth of contamination.
Minor Structural Repairs (e.g., drywall patch) $500 – $2,000 Extent of damage, materials needed, and labor involved.
Deodorizing Treatments $200 – $750 Severity of odor and size of the area requiring treatment.

Common Questions About Clean Water Damage Restoration (Category 1)

What’s the difference between Category 1 and Category 2 water damage?

Category 1 water damage involves clean, potable water with no significant contaminants. Think of a burst pipe or a refrigerator leak. Category 2 water, or “gray water,” contains some impurities and poses a health risk. Category 3, or “black water,” is highly contaminated and dangerous. How long does it take to dry out a home after clean water damage?

The drying process can vary significantly, typically taking anywhere from three to seven days. Factors like the amount of water, the materials affected (e.g., carpet vs. hardwood), and the size of the space all play a role. Will my homeowner’s insurance cover clean water damage restoration?

Generally, homeowner’s insurance policies cover damage from sudden and accidental sources like pipe bursts or appliance failures, which fall under Category 1. However, it’s always best to check your specific policy details. We can work with your insurance adjuster to make the claims process as smooth as possible.

What health risks are associated with Category 1 water damage if not treated properly?

While Category 1 water is initially clean, if left untreated, it can quickly become a breeding ground for mold and bacteria within 24-48 hours. This can lead to allergy symptoms, respiratory issues, and other health problems. Prompt remediation by our team is crucial for preventing secondary contamination and ensuring a healthy environment.

How can I prevent clean water damage in my home?

Regular maintenance is key. Inspect hoses on appliances like washing machines and dishwashers for wear and tear, and replace them every 5 years. Check your plumbing for any signs of leaks or corrosion, and consider insulating pipes in unheated areas to prevent freezing and bursting. Being proactive can save you from future headaches and costly repairs.
